Avoid Zero Day: How to Plan Water-Resilient Cities - Country Circular

Summary by paiscircular.cl
41 visits The “Zero Day”–when the available water is not enough to meet the basic needs of the population–is no longer a hypothetical scenario. In Cape Town, South Africa, it was weeks away from reaching it in 2018; in Monterrey, Mexico, there were massive water cuts in 2022; and in Chennai, India, the 2019 drought dried up virtually all urban reservoirs.
